NRG Energy's stock rose 5.4% following investor reassessment after its Q2 update that reaffirmed 2026 financial guidance and introduced a new 1.2 GW data-center power project in Texas with potential expansion. The project aligns with a leading cloud and AI client and is expected to generate significant EBITDA and free cash flow, supported by ongoing share buybacks and higher capacity prices in the Eastern US.
